Alexander Wang is a contemporary fashion designer known for sharp tailoring, urban influences, and a precise color palette. His work balances minimalist structure with subtle experimentation, creating a signature look that resonates across ready-to-wear, accessories, and fragrance.
Across runways and editorials, he has built a reputation for thoughtful details and an understated aesthetic that appeals to a global audience seeking modern, wearable design.
| Category | Key Detail | Signature Element |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Founder | Alexander Wang | Chinese-American background | Bridges Eastern nuance and Western tailoring |
| Launch | 2005 | Edgy yet refined shapes | Quickly entered luxury streetwear discourse |
| Positioning | Modern luxury | Monochrome tones, precise seams | Appeals to minimalist and fashion-forward consumers |
| Global Reach | International boutiques and e-commerce | Flagship stores in key cities | Strengthens brand visibility and desirability |
The Alexander Wang Brand Identity
Alexander Wang positions itself at the intersection of technical precision and street-level awareness, offering garments that feel both elevated and accessible. The label emphasizes clean silhouettes, functional details, and a restrained yet confident mood.
From logo placement to material choices, the brand maintains a consistent visual language. This coherence reinforces recognition while leaving room for creative experimentation season after season.
Design Philosophy and Aesthetic
Balance between edge and elegance
Wang’s designs pair utilitarian elements with refined draping, creating looks that move easily from day to evening. Structured blazers sit alongside softly gathered skirts, highlighting his nuanced approach.
Attention to detail and construction
Seamwork, lining, and finishing receive careful attention, ensuring longevity and comfort. This focus on craft supports the brand’s modern luxury positioning.
